PLM操作系统如何实现数据集成?
随着企业信息化的不断发展,产品生命周期管理(PLM)系统在企业中的应用越来越广泛。PLM系统作为一种综合性的管理系统,能够帮助企业实现产品从设计、研发、生产到售后服务全生命周期的管理。而数据集成作为PLM系统的重要组成部分,对于提升企业信息化管理水平具有重要意义。本文将详细介绍PLM操作系统如何实现数据集成。
一、PLM系统数据集成概述
PLM系统数据集成是指将企业内部不同业务系统、外部系统以及各种数据源中的数据,通过一定的技术手段进行整合、清洗、转换和存储,最终实现数据共享和协同应用的过程。数据集成的主要目的是提高数据质量、降低数据冗余、提高数据利用率和系统协同效率。
二、PLM系统数据集成技术
- 数据抽取技术
数据抽取技术是指从源系统中抽取所需数据的过程。常见的抽取技术包括:
(1)全量抽取:定期从源系统中抽取全部数据,适用于数据量较小、更新频率较低的场景。
(2)增量抽取:仅抽取自上次抽取以来发生变化的数据,适用于数据量较大、更新频率较高的场景。
(3)触发式抽取:根据特定事件触发数据抽取,如数据变更、定时任务等。
- 数据清洗技术
数据清洗技术是指对抽取到的数据进行处理,消除数据中的错误、缺失、冗余等问题。常见的清洗技术包括:
(1)数据去重:识别并删除重复数据,提高数据质量。
(2)数据转换:将不同格式的数据转换为统一格式,便于后续处理。
(3)数据补全:对缺失数据进行填充,提高数据完整性。
- 数据转换技术
数据转换技术是指将清洗后的数据转换为PLM系统所需的数据格式。常见的转换技术包括:
(1)数据映射:将源数据与目标数据之间的对应关系进行映射。
(2)数据转换规则:根据业务需求,制定数据转换规则。
(3)数据格式转换:将数据转换为PLM系统支持的数据格式。
- 数据存储技术
数据存储技术是指将转换后的数据存储到PLM系统中。常见的存储技术包括:
(1)关系型数据库:适用于结构化数据存储,如MySQL、Oracle等。
(2)非关系型数据库:适用于非结构化数据存储,如MongoDB、Redis等。
(3)数据仓库:适用于大规模数据存储和分析,如Teradata、Hadoop等。
三、PLM系统数据集成实施步骤
需求分析:了解企业内部业务需求、数据来源、数据格式等,明确数据集成目标。
系统选型:根据需求分析结果,选择合适的PLM系统和数据集成工具。
数据源接入:实现与源系统的数据连接,包括数据抽取、清洗、转换等。
数据映射:建立源数据与目标数据之间的映射关系。
数据转换:根据映射关系,对源数据进行转换,生成符合PLM系统要求的数据格式。
数据存储:将转换后的数据存储到PLM系统中。
数据验证:对存储在PLM系统中的数据进行验证,确保数据质量。
系统优化:根据实际应用情况,对数据集成系统进行优化和调整。
四、PLM系统数据集成优势
提高数据质量:通过数据清洗、转换等技术,提高数据准确性、完整性和一致性。
降低数据冗余:避免重复数据存储,减少数据存储空间占用。
提高数据利用率:实现数据共享和协同应用,提高数据价值。
提升系统协同效率:实现不同业务系统之间的数据互通,提高企业信息化管理水平。
降低运维成本:简化数据集成过程,降低运维难度和成本。
总之,PLM系统数据集成是实现企业信息化管理的重要手段。通过采用合适的技术和实施步骤,可以有效提高数据质量、降低数据冗余、提高数据利用率和系统协同效率,为企业创造更大的价值。
猜你喜欢:PDM